2024 Community Case Study Challenge
Parks & Recreation professionals, high school students, and college students spent a day working together to find innovative solutions to address real-world challenges in Arizona communities! Topics revolved around issues related to individuals experiencing homelessness🏠; public art as a tool for crime reduction🎨; and youth sports and youth development🏀
